A couple things, make sure the flap is in the right position (closed 100%) when the valve is mounted to the exhaust or connected with the pin. BC button should be able to switch the flap (both blinkers indicate it's associated with the drive mode and not overridden by the JB4). If it doesn't...
Once or twice I had to go and repeatedly switch it until it worked. Back up against a wall and you'll also have an easier time hearing it switch, especially if you have a quieter exhaust.
